Een backup van uw servers (VMs) helpt u bij het herstellen van verloren of beschadigde data. Maar als het gaat over tijd is replicatie wat u nodig hebt! Replicatie betekent een werkende kopie van uw server op een fysiek aparte locatie. De […]

The simple answer is no – search engine submission isn’t necessary. The majority of search engines nowadays (most notably Google) crawl and index pages by following links. Using that logic, a single inbound link from any already-indexed page will identify your page to the engine. Subsequently, if that page links to other pages within your site, they […]

The importance of anchor text with respect to a linking strategy cannot be overstated. Back-links are a huge part of the search engine algorithm. When initiating a linking campaign, it is vital that external sites link using the appropriate keywords and terms in the anchor text.
